Honey Wheat Bread
Modified from my mother's bread machine manual

***Recommend bread machine use, but you could also cook this in the oven if you really wanted****

1/2 cup plus 1/2 tbsp warm water
1/2 egg (put in a bowl, mix and then dump in what looks like half - the problems of trying to convert recipes, if you bread machine can make a 2 lb loaf you don't have to worry)
1 tbsp honey
1 tbsp butter
1/2 tsp salt
1 1/4 cups bread flour (I'd actually use bread flour, it makes a difference - I've tried both ways)
3/8 cups whole wheat flour
1 1/4 tsp bread machine yeast (I don't know if I actually use that stuff - I buy the big bag at Sam's Club)

Put the ingredients in bread maker in order unless your machine says to put in yeast first then reverse the liquid and dry ingredient order.

Set bread machine to basic/normal setting, medium crust. Press start

Remove bread at end of cycle and cool.

Makes a 1 lb loaf.
